A ball starts with velocity 4 cm/sec and ends with a velocity of 10 cm/sec.
What is your best guess about the ball's average velocity?
answer/question/discussion: ->->->->->->->->->->->-> (start in the next line):
Best guess would be done by averaging the two velocities, 4 + 10 = 14, 14 / 2 = 7, so 7 cm/s.

If it takes 3 seconds to get from the first velocity to the second, then what is your best guess about how far it traveled during that time?
answer/question/discussion: ->->->->->->->->->->->-> (start in the next line):
Given the avg. rate of 7cm/s over a 3 second interval, you would have 21 cm.
#$&*
At what average rate did its velocity change with respect to clock time during this interval?
answer/question/discussion: ->->->->->->->->->->->-> (start in the next line):
Take the 10 cm/s minus the 4 cm/s to get a change of 6 cm/s, then divide by the 3 second time interval, you get 2 cm/s/s of change.
